Earnings for Business & Commerce Graduates from Columbia Central University-Caguas
Students who complete Columbia Central University-Caguas’s Business & Commerce program earn the following amounts (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$25,149 |
| 2 years | $33,993 |
| 4 years | $30,738 |
| 5 years | $32,438 |
How do these earnings stack up against the rest of the school? Four years after graduating, Business & Commerce graduates from Columbia Central University-Caguas report median earnings of $30,738, compared with $33,842 for all Columbia Central University-Caguas graduates — about 9% lower than the school-wide median.
